How they compare

Argentina currently reports 29,868 t against 29,572 t in Chile, a difference of 296 t.

The two have swapped places 12 times across 22 shared years of data; in 1997 it was Argentina ahead.

Argentina ranks 39th and Chile ranks 40th of 153 countries.

Across the 3 decades both report, Argentina averaged higher in 1 and Chile in 2.

Head to head by decade

Decade Argentina Chile Difference Ahead
1990s 31,737 t 29,019 t 2,718 t Argentina
2000s 21,218 t 32,625 t 11,407 t Chile
2010s 35,623 t 40,991 t 5,368 t Chile

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
